Does anyone have any experience with FMLA and Short Term Disability? I am being told that time is concurrent. I was told earlier in my pregnancy that its 6 weeks STD, and then up to 12 weeks FMLA. What has everyone here experienced?

    My STD was the first 6 weeks of my 12 weeks FMLA. I got paid 66% of my salary during those 6 weeks and then could supplement the rest with my sick/vacation time.

    Mine is the same as pp, though I haven't used it yet!  66% salary, 6 weeks.  8 weeks for c section.  12 weeks total time off, can use as much of my sick time to supplement.

    It depends on your employer.  As a federal employee I was able to take my 6 wks STD and then invoke my 12 wks of FMLA for a total "excused" absence of 18 weeks (20 if c/s).
